/soilDT

soilDT: the soil classification app

Primary LanguageJavaApache License 2.0Apache-2.0

soilDT: the soil classification app

Título da proposta

Desenvolvimento de um Software Livre e de Código Aberto para o Aprendizado Ativo da Classificação de Solos

Tema de estudo

Modelos digitais para representação de sistemas ou processos aplicados ao ambiente rural

Proponente (coordenador)

Prof. Dr. Alessandro Samuel-Rosa

Resumo geral

O Sistema Brasileiro de Classificação de Solos (SiBCS) foi construído sem considerar aspectos didáticos que concernem o ensino ao nível de graduação. O caráter quali-quantitativo e a multidimensionalidade dos critérios taxonômicos exigem raciocínio lógico-matemático avançado na sua aplicação. Isso faz com que o aprendizado da classificação de solos dependa de intenso e dedicado acompanhamento docente. Com o desenvolvimento das atividades de ensino em modo não presencial, esse acompanhamento é dificultado, por exemplo, pela incompatibilidade de horários entre docente e discentes e falta de tutores. A presente proposta apresenta uma solução para esse problema: decompor os critérios taxonômicos multidimensionais do SiBCS em regras de decisão de saída binária. Uma aplicação para dispositivos móveis será desenvolvida para tornar a navegação entre as regras de decisão amigável e intuitiva. Com ela, os alunos serão capazes de aplicar o SiBCS com mínimo acompanhamento docente, bem como aplicá-lo a uma gama maior de solos dos biomas brasileiros. Para docentes, a menor demanda possibilitará desenvolver novos materiais e atividades para o processo de ensino e aprendizagem. Tais benefícios serão sentidos pelos cursos da UTFPR que oferecem disciplinas da área da Ciência do Solo, principalmente a classificação do solo. Isso inclui cursos de graduação das Ciências Agrárias (Agronomia, Engenharia Florestal e Zootecnia) e de Engenharia Ambiental e Civil, bem como programas de pós-graduação como de Tecnologias Computacionais para o Agronegócio e Agroecossistemas. Além disso, serão beneficiados cursos das Ciências Agrárias da Universidade Federal de Santa Maria (UFSM) e Universidade Federal Rural do Rio de Janeiro (UFRRJ), parceiras no desenvolvimento da presente proposta. Como os produtos desta proposta têm o potencial de substituir os métodos de ensino da classificação de solos usados no ensino presencial, espera-se que, no médio prazo, os benefícios sejam sentidos por todas as universidades brasileiras.

Objetivo da proposta

Viabilizar o aprendizado ativo da classificação de solos, desenvolvendo aplicativo livre e de código aberto do Sistema Brasileiro de Classificação de Solos para sistema operacional Android.

Resultados e materiais digitais previstos

No curto prazo, almeja-se alcançar os seguintes resultados e produtos:

  1. Aplicação digital com interface gráfica para classificação de solos,
  2. Base de dados com regras lógico-matemáticas do SiBCS,
  3. Código fonte aberto da aplicação para celular e
  4. Relatório de implementação com soluções para possíveis inconsistências encontradas no SiBCS.

O relatório de implementação, a base de dados e o código fonte serão enviados ao Comitê Executivo do SiBCS para alimentar seu desenvolvimento e viabilizar a implementação de atualizações. No médio prazo, a proposta deverá resultar num artigo científico a ser submetido para publicação na Revista Brasileira de Ciência do Solo. No longo prazo, a UTFPR se consolidará como instituição chave na produção de recursos digitais para o ensino de solos e desenvolvimento do SiBCS.

Metodologia da proposta

Os critérios taxonômicos multidimensionais do SiBCS serão decompostos em regras de decisão de saída binária. O modelo digital de representação resultante—um diagrama de árvore de decisão—terá estrutura similar àquela de sistemas de sistemática e taxonomia biológica, os quais são conhecidos pelos alunos desde o ensino médio. Uma aplicação para dispositivos móveis com sistema operacional Android será desenvolvida para tornar a navegação nesse diagrama amigável e intuitiva. Nela, apenas uma regra de decisão será apresentada por vez, abstraindo a estrutura multidimensional subjacente do SiBCS. Para cada regra, um menu de ajuda apresentará os conceitos e definições exigidos e oferecerá dicas sobre como analisar os dados. Como resultado, os alunos serão capazes de aplicar o SiBCS com mínimo acompanhamento docente, bastando que lhe tenham sido apresentados os conceitos fundamentais da classificação de solos. Além disso, a simplificação do SiBCS permitirá aos alunos aplicá-lo a uma gama maior de solos dos biomas brasileiros. Isso significa ganhar amplo conhecimento sobre os solos brasileiros e desenvolver entendimento aprofundado da estrutura e funcionamento do SiBCS e processos de produção de informação de recursos do solo em geral. Quanto ao desenvolvimento do modelo digital de representação do SiBCS, será preciso construir uma base de dados com seus critérios taxonômicos. Isso será realizado utilizando ferramentas web gratuitas e contará com o auxílio de especialistas da UFRRJ, UFSM e Embrapa Solos. Para o desenvolvimento da aplicação, será utilizado a plataforma de desenvolvimento integrado Android Studio (sob licença Apache 2.0 - software livre) e linguagem de programação Java (sob licença GNU General Public License - software livre), para o que será fundamental a atuação do aluno bolsista. A última fase consistirá na validação da base de dados e da aplicação, realizadas por especialistas da UFRRJ, UFSM, IBGE e Embrapa Informática Agropecuária. Os custos envolvidos com a atuação dos membros externos ficarão sob responsabilidade daqueles.


EDITAL 37/2020 - PROGRAD. SELEÇÃO DE ESTUDANTES BOLSISTAS E VOLUNTÁRIOS PARA O APOIO AO DESENVOLVIMENTO DE RECURSOS EDUCACIONAIS ABERTOS NA GRADUAÇÃO DA UTFPR (RETIFICADO em 29/01/2021). https://sei.utfpr.edu.br/sei/publicacoes/controlador_publicacoes.php?acao=publicacao_visualizar&id_documento=2039976&id_orgao_publicacao=0